With all due respect asl42, if anybody has a passion for flying airplanes, they will do it somewhere else. The new SO's will be spending 5 years as SO, and will not be flying anything but a simulator! There is effectively no bypass pay in the conditions of service, so if anybody is hired in a higher rank than you then you are not entitled to bypass pay. If you ever want to get back to your home country, you might not get the chance for 7 to 9 years! I'm going to have to just go ahead and disagree with you; If you are a local, the pay for SO is absurd compared to other professional positions!

If you want to come to Cathay; do it. But do so as a manager. They make the big bucks, and still get to fly on airplanes. Go get a law degree, and an MBA and you are set and will be better off.
